Got a free month of Claude Code, and have made the most of it. I wonder if designers would find this extension useful - let me know, I'm thinking of open-sourcing it. Currently upgrading it and trying to add a Figma plugin addition too.
Essentially, it's a reverse engineering tool. Most things these days are idea to design based, but I wanted to go from production grade design understanding BACK to Figma or code. So i made a chrome extension that does that.
I select any page element on any site and I get all sorts of outputs:
- svg wireframe with Figma recreation instructions
- AI prompt to guide LLMs on rebuilding components or layouts
- All the code outputs Tailwind, React Components ETC.

I wanted my own Raycast-like design tool that I could pop open with a hotkey combo while working on any project. So I vibed it into existence on my mac in a single day. Opus 4.5 is no joke.
Some minor flaws but loving it so far.
For anyone wondering I made this with Claude Code using this workflow:
1. Discuss the project idea and initialized the Xcode project (Swift + Swift UI based) - Opus did this without issue.
2. Brainstormed the workflow pattern in plan mode with Claude for the best path to get all features working as expected
3. Build one feature at a time, frequently unit & integration test them, then commit to a proper branched git repo.
4. Also, if i thought Opus wasn't fully seeing the vision, I'd have Gemini 3 run double checks or give its own ideas.
Highly recommend trying this out, build your own tools!
